How does this site work?

We gather reviews from reputable pickleball content creators, each providing:
• A sentiment based on their review: Highly Recommended, Worth Trying, Mixed Feelings, Not Recommended
• A breakdown of pros and cons
• A summary of their thoughts
• Links to their reviews

This allows players to compare multiple expert perspectives in one place before making a decision.

How did you pick your reviewers?

We curate reviews from respected pickleball reviewers who regularly test paddles and share their findings online. We only include reviewers who do not accept payment in exchange for reviews, conduct independent testing, and have built a reputation for accuracy, ethical standards, and insightful analysis.

Why don't you use a numeric scoring system?

Numbers can be misleading—one reviewer’s 8/10 might mean something completely different from another’s. Instead, we use tiered recommendations to highlight whether a paddle is widely praised, divisive, or best avoided.
